Event overview

This fell race takes place on Wed 26 Aug 2026 at Roseberry Topping in the North York Moors, England. The senior race is part of the Esk Valley Fell Club Summer Series. The venue is Newton under Roseberry car park, near Great Ayton (postcode TS9 6QS). A grid reference is provided for the location.

Race details

The course distance is 2.3 km / 1.4 miles with 217 m / 712 ft of climb. Category: AS. Skills code: LK. Minimum age for entry is 11. Junior races are held; U10, U12, U14, U16, U18 and U20 runners run with the senior race. Parental consent is required for all under-18s.

Entry and logistics

Pre-entry is not available. Entry on the day is allowed. Entry on the day fees are £5 for members and £6 for non-members; a universal entry form is used. Teams are allowed, with team sizes listed as three for men and three for women. The event has a permit and associated UK Athletics insurance from the FRA. Limited Pay & Display parking is available in Newton-under-Roseberry.

Records

Male course record: 00:10:20 (1992).
Female course record: 00:13:36 (1990).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
